This is a guide to replace the motherboard of the JBL GO 4 Speaker.
This should be considered when the speaker has charging issues, power failures, audio distortion, or other such problems. This is generally considered a last resort

*Note: The device used in this guide is a non-genuine model, so the internal components may look different from those in your authentic device. However, the replacement procedure remains roughly the same and should still apply to your device.

Use an opening tool to pry off both sides of the speaker cover.

Remove the Phillips screws securing the motherboard.

Gently remove the white and red pieces from their connectors on the motherboard with your hands.

Use an opening tool to pry the motherboard away from the rest of the speaker.

To reassemble your device, follow these instructions in reverse order. Take your e-waste to an R2 or e-Stewards certified recycler.
